What matters most when evaluating wattage and runtime for a led bulb for generator use?
Wattage directly affects brightness and the load on your generator. Runtime depends on the bulb’s power draw and its internal battery or charging method. For a led bulb for generator use, a 12W rechargeable option often runs longer on a charge than a higher‑wattage choice, though it may be brighter; pick the balance that fits your outage duration and lighting needs.
Which led bulb for generator use is best for a home blackout versus camping?
For a home blackout, choose rechargeable emergency bulbs with longer runtimes and reliable charging. For camping, prioritize portability and versatile form factors such as USB lanterns or compact 12V DC bulbs that pair well with portable power stations. A USB LED Light Bulb is great for reading and tasks around a campsite, while 12V DC options offer sturdy, plug‑in flexibility for off‑grid setups.
What maintenance and compatibility checks keep a led bulb for generator use safe and effective?
Check that the bulb’s base and voltage match your power source, whether 12V DC, USB, or a socket. Confirm mounting options and housing material, such as ABS, and use the correct charging adapters. For safe operation with a led bulb for generator use, store in dry conditions and avoid overcharging or exposure to moisture.
